Five9, Inc. Chief Revenue Officer Matthew E. Tuckness reported a mandated tax-related share sale. On this Form 4, he sold 5,164 shares of Five9 common stock at a weighted average price of $17.87 per share in an open-market transaction to cover tax withholding obligations from vesting restricted stock units. After this transaction, he directly held 290,137 Five9 shares. The filing notes this was not a discretionary trade by the executive.
Five9, Inc. reported an insider transaction by Chief Administrative and Legal Officer Tiffany N. Meriweather. On March 4, 2026, she executed an open-market sale of 5,942 shares of Five9 common stock at a weighted average price of $17.87 per share.
According to the filing, this was a company-mandated sale to cover tax withholding obligations arising from the vesting and settlement of restricted stock units, and was not a discretionary trade. After this tax-related sale, she directly held 311,115 shares of Five9 common stock.
Five9, Inc.’s Chief Financial Officer Bryan M. Lee reported automatic share sales tied to equity compensation taxes. On March 4 and 5, 2026, he sold a total of 11,611 shares of Five9 common stock in open-market transactions at weighted average prices around $17.70–$17.92 per share.
The sales were effected under a pre-established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on September 3, 2025 and were made to cover taxes upon the vesting of restricted stock units. After these transactions, Lee directly owned 328,082 Five9 shares.
